Title

EFFECT OF PISTACHIO RESIDUE BIOCHAR PREPARED AT TWO DIFFERENT TEMPERATURES AND DIFFERENT NITROGEN AND PHOSPHORUS LEVELS ON SOME MACRONUTRIENTS CONCENTRATION AND SPINACH GROWTH

Pages

  557-569

Abstract

 Introduction: Application of chemical FERTILIZER is one of the methods to supply nutrient elements for plants and it is an effective method to meet plants nutrients demands; but organic FERTILIZERs such as biochar application can be used as a proper solution to decrease gases resulted from agricultural activities, increase soil's organic matters and to manage soil fertility. Biochar can increase soil fertility of some soils, increase agricultural productivity, and provide protection against some foliar and soil-borne diseases. Biochar is a high-carbon charcoal used as a soil amendment and it is made of plant biomass and produced during pyrolysis process in the absence of oxygen. The ability of biochar to store C and improve soil fertility will depend on its physical and chemical properties, which can be varied in the pyrolysis process (pyrolysis temperature) or through the choice of raw materials. …
